Prevalence of obesity, female in Mozambique
Mozambique: Prevalence of obesity, female was 14.5% in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Prevalence of obesity, female in Mozambique, 1980–2024
Source: World Health Organization (WHO):Global Health Observatory Data Repository. Measured in % of female population ages 18+.
Analysis
In 2024, prevalence of obesity, female in Mozambique stood at 14.5%. That is the highest value across all 45 years on record.
The figure is up 4.4% on the previous year and up 58.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, prevalence of obesity, female in Mozambique peaked at 14.5%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 1.6%, in 1980.
Mozambique ranks 163rd of 196 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Prevalence of obesity adult is the percentage of adults ages 18 and over whose Body Mass Index (BMI) is 30 kg/m² or higher. Body Mass Index (BMI) is a simple index of weight-for-height, or the weight in kilograms divided by the square of the height in meters.
